Transaction 96f17a8aa7a53c8da5c386c6a2dfe7a38814c05d9458e5e538904516f89236e1
1 Input
1 Output
-
96f17a8aa7a53c8da5c386c6a2dfe7a38814c05d9458e5e538904516f89236e1:0
- value
- 5222783
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d7bf8cdffa053c81ff8293be6e00e4ba693a48a
- address
- bc1qh4al3n0l5pfus8lc9ya7dcqwfwnf8fy2zvldse